Course content
- Selecting a place to build a hotel - Construction of a hotel - Exterior architecture, interior furnishings - Identity of a hotel - Advertising, guidebooks, and travel agencies - Customers and the staff - Activities of a hotel (how to inform and advise) - Providing assistance, selling, and payments - Correspondence (messages and notes) - Welcoming a distinguished guest - Organising events - External communication - Change of the hotel owner

learning outcomes
Knowledge
- describe the external and internal architecture of a hotel and its equipment
- name and describe the elements of oral and written communication related to the operation of a hotel (communication with staff and guests).
Skills
- respond linguistically correctly in real situations in the field of tourism
- use grammatical structures and specific vocabulary,
- understand authentic documents used in the tourist and hotel industry.
